FedEx Leverages IIT Expertise to Build Smarter, AI-Driven Supply Chains

Vishal Talwar, EVP and Chief Digital & Information Officer, FedEx, and President, FedEx Dataworks, interacts with IITB-FedEx ALFA students on tech-driven supply chain solutions.

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], October 15: Vishal Talwar, executive vice president, chief digital and information officer of FedEx Corporation, and president, FedEx Dataworks, visited IIT Bombay to engage with faculty and students from IIT Bombay and IIT Madras. The visit highlights FedEx commitment to leverage academic expertise to advance digitally led, efficient, and resilient supply chains.
